The OP got me thinking about the funeral of Princess Diana. It is the biggest in living memory (I'd go as far to say it's the biggest funeral ever, as I cannot think of another before her that comes remotely close). It was mania.

The most famous woman on the planet, in an era where media was infinitely more concentrated than it is now (pre internet), she didn't share the spotlight she dominated it.

The rewritten "Candle in the Wind" sold 33 million physical copies globally (in terms of physical sales it is the biggest selling record ever, and all sold within a month), and it charted at #1 all over the world.

https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Candle_in_the_Wind_1997#Weekly_charts

To this day I have never known a week like the one following her death to the day of the funeral. It was surreal. No one person has ever taken over everything like that. Newspapers (from the front page to about the middle pages all about her), television shows dominated by her. Wall to wall coverage. And the flowers, my God you could have filled a field with those stacked outside Kensington Palace.

The internet era folks got a wee taste of a large event with the Queen's death, but nothing remotely close to the scale of Diana. We won't ever see anything like that again as its impossible for anything to be that concentrated on one individual with the media being so much broader with audiences spread out.
